Introduction to ARIES• ARIES (Algorithm for Recovery and Isolation Exploiting Semantics)• ARIES is a recovery algorithm• When the recovery manager is invoked after a crash, restart

proceeds in three phases.• Analysis phase. Determines the earliest log record from which the

next pass must start. • It also scans the log forward from the checkpoint record to construct

a snapshot of what the system looked like at the instant of the crash.• Redo phase. it repeats all actions, starting from an appropriate point

in the log, and restores the database state to what it was at the time of the crash.

• Undo phase. it undoes the actions of transactions that did not commit, so that the database reflects only the actions of committed transactions.

Introduction to ARIES• In addition to the log, the following two tables contain important

recovery related information:• Transaction Table:• Dirty page table:• Transaction Table: This table contains one entry for each active

transaction.• 'The entry contains the transaction id, the status, and a field called

lastLSN, which is the LSN of the most recent log record for this transaction.

• The status of a transaction can be that it is in progress, or aborted• Dirty page table: This table contains one entry for each dirty page in

the buffer pool, that is, each page with changes not yet reflected on disk.

• The entry contains a field rec LSN, which is the LSN of the first log record that caused the page to become dirty.

• During normal operation, these are maintained by the transaction manager and the buffer manager, respectively, and during restart after a crash, these tables are reconstructed in the Analysis phase of restart.

Distributed Database System

• A distributed database (DDB) is a collection of multiple, logically interrelated databases distributed over a computer network.

• A distributed database management system (D–DBMS) is the software that manages the DDB and provides an access mechanism that makes this distribution transparent to the users.

• Disadvantages• N/W connection problem: technical problem may be

generated when we want to connect dissimilar machines

• Data security problem: security problem increases when data are located at multiple sites

• Data integrity problem: because date are access from many locations and perform some operations like select, update, maintaining the integrity is a big issue

• Cost: large communication n/w is maintained so h/w & s/w implementation cost is high

Distributed database design• Data fragmentation• It allows to break a single object into two or more segments

or fragments• The object might be database or a table• Each fragment can be store at any site over a computer n/w• Data fragmentation information is stored in the distributed

data catalog• Data fragmentation can be classified as• Horizontal fragmentation• Vertical fragmentation• Mixed fragmentation

Page 17: Transaction. Introduction to ARIES ARIES (Algorithm for Recovery and Isolation Exploiting Semantics) ARIES is a recovery algorithm When the recovery

Distributed database design• Data fragmentation• Horizontal fragmentation• It refers to the division of a relation into subset of

tuples (rows)• Each fragments is stored at a different nodes• We can use selection capability in SQL to choose

the rows in a table that we want to b returned by a query

• Vertical fragmentation• It refers to division of a relation into attributes

(columns) subset• Each fragments is stored at a different nodes• We can use projection capability in SQL to choose

the columns in a table that we want to b returned by a query

Distributed database design• Data Replication• Data replication can be performed in three ways• Fully replicated database: it stores multiple copies

of each database fragments at multiple sites• Here all database fragments are replicated• Partially replicated database: it stores multiple

copies of some database fragment at multiple sites• Most DDMS are able to handle the partial

replicated database well• Unreplicated database : it stores each database

fragment at a single site
